BI4 webi report export to excel save as issue

Hello

I am using BI4 sp6. when I tried to export any webi report and tried to open and then save it, I am seeing a warning message -

“errors were detected while saving abc.xls Microsoft Excel may be able to save the file by removing or repairing some features. To make the repairs in anew file, click continue”

and after I click continue, its saving the document with no issues and can open it and work with no errors

I see that by default the save as type is ‘Microsoft Excel 97-2003 worksheet’ and I am having excel 2010 in my machine.

Is it that BI4 exports reports to excel 97-2003 version by default irrespective of the version you are using in your machine ?

No, it offers both options.

Export as Excel saves as a .xls file
Export as Excel 2007 saves as a .xlsx file

You want Excel 2007

Yes. That’s because the Save as Excel option in BO4 is the same as the old Save as Excel in XI3 - it saves as a .xls file.
From Excel 2007 onwards, Excel moved on to a .xlsx file extension. If you’re on Excel 2011, you’ll want to save as Excel 2007.
